People often ask for “stronger” pressure as if it’s the main indicator of a good massage.

But pressure is just one variable.

The body doesn’t respond to force alone —
it responds to how that force is perceived.

Too little can feel ineffective.
Too much can trigger protection.

More pressure is easy.
Appropriate pressure is skill.

Someone recently asked me what I exactly do to make my studio a safe space.

Well, safety is not a decoration. It's not a sticker on the door. Or a slogan in my bio.
It's practice.
It's hygiene.
It's boundaries that are respected.
It's asking before adjusting.
It's not assuming gender, pain tolerance, or body story.
For many people (especially q***r bodies) safety should not be a luxury in healthcare spaces, but a basic condition that makes regulation possible.
Before technique.
Before pressure.
Before heat.
Safety first.

I’ve introduced a new session in the studio.

Slow Stone is built around sustained warmth and unhurried pressure.

Heat is not decoration.
It’s a stimulus that can reduce muscle tone, change sensory input, and support nervous system regulation.

This is not a detox ritual.
It’s structured, slow, and deliberate.

As always, screening is part of the process — heat is powerful and not suitable in every case.

Slow Stone is now available.

This week I had someone urgently seeking massage to treat their neck pain. I know sudden pain can feel dramatic, but it rarely is.

In uncomplicated cases, it’s usually a temporary increase in sensitivity — not serious damage.

Most flare-ups respond well to simple load management, gentle movement, time, and sometimes topical anti-inflammatories.

Knowing when to seek medical care matters.
Knowing when to stay calm matters just as much.

This is how I think about acute pain — both professionally and personally.
